UH-OH:Mohamed Ouazzani, one of those arrested in connection with the Madrid train bombs, has retracted an earlier statement in which he linked the attacks to Spain’s presence in Iraq. He told judge Del Olmo that several Spanish police and a Moroccan had beaten and threatened him in December 2004, to tell judge Baltasar Garzon that the bombs were linked to Iraq.The information was revealed by Madrid’s El Mundo; more information in Spanish on their website here (only a fraction is free to read, but full article re-published here)
